Job description

At Medik8, we’re not just creating award-winning skincare – we’re setting new standards in quality and innovation. As we continue to grow globally, we’re looking for a Quality Assurance Team Leader to play a key role in ensuring our products meet and exceed the high expectations of our customers.

The ideal candidate is proactive and detail-oriented, with experience in a GMP-regulated environment. With strong problem-solving skills, they can confidently review deviations, complaints, and CAPAs, ensuring compliance and driving continuous improvement. They are an effective leader who can motivate and develop a team while fostering a strong ‘quality-first’ mindset.

This 6 month fixed term contract is a full-time, onsite role, based at our Innovation Centre in Aylesbury. You’ll be leading a team of 3 Quality Assurance Operatives, working hands-on in a dynamic environment where collaboration, expertise, and a shared passion for excellence drive real impact.

In more detail your role will include:

  • Leadingand managing a team of Quality Assurance Operatives, providing coaching, development, and day-to-day support.
  • Ensuring compliance by reviewing batch documentation against written instructions.
  • Reviewing, investigating, and approving minor deviations and complaints for closure, ensuring corrective actions are implemented effectively.
  • Reviewing, tracking, and approving CAPAs to ensure corrective and preventive actions are followed through to completion.
  • Overseeing the Quality Management System (QMS), ensuring documentation (SOPs/WIs) is reviewed and implemented effectively.
  • Maintaining high standards by monitoring hygiene, quality, and product safety on a daily basis.
  • Identifying and reporting issues, supporting investigations into deviations and complaints.
  • Driving operational improvements through ad hoc projects that enhance production and logistics processes.

About us

Founded in 2009 by UK scientists and brothers, Elliot and Daniel Isaacs, we are a British, B Corp certified dermatological skincare brand, globally renowned for our age-defying heroes that deliver results without compromise.

Our mission is to simplify the route to great skin through the highest quality, most efficacious and trusted products on the market. All this is underpinned by our pioneering CSA Philosophy of vitamin C plus sunscreen by day, and vitamin A (retinoids) by night which addresses 90% of anti-ageing skincare needs to deliver more youthful-looking skin.
